Cybozu, Inc. (Headquarters: Chuo-ku, Tokyo; President: Yoshihisa Aono; hereinafter referred to as Cybozu) will release the fourth installment of its TV commercials for "kintone," a no-code tool that allows users to build business systems with AI and drag-and-drop operations. The new commercials are titled "AI Everyone Can Use" and "Everyone is Accumulating." In addition to actor Etsushi Toyokawa, Kazunori Kishibe will be a new cast member. These TV commercials will begin airing nationwide sequentially starting Monday, July 13, 2026. Furthermore, starting Monday, July 6, 2026, transit advertising will be displayed in major stations in the Tokyo metropolitan area and other key locations where many users commute.

Background of New Commercial Production
In recent years, while interest in AI utilization has been growing, its actual application often remains limited to improving individual work efficiency, with many cases failing to achieve organization-wide AI utilization. To realize AI utilization optimized for one's own company, it is necessary not only to accumulate data but also to prepare the data with the goal of enabling AI usage within the team.
Cybozu's kintone not only allows users to "create business apps with no-code" but can also be utilized as a "data foundation where data usable by AI is naturally accumulated" through daily operations. This commercial was produced to encourage more managers to take the first step towards AI utilization for their entire team.

kintone CM Series Cast
Manager Toyokawa: Etsushi Toyokawa
He gained attention in 1990 for his role in Takeshi Kitano's film "3-4x October." Since then, he has appeared in films such as "12 Japanese Gentle People" (1991), "Sparkling Light" (1992), "Love Letter" (1995), and "The Eight-Tomb Village" (1996). In television dramas, his leading roles in "NIGHT HEAD" (Fuji TV/1992-93), "Say You Love Me" (TBS/1995), and "Blue Bird" (TBS/1997) were major hits, establishing him as a leading actor in Japan in terms of both popularity and skill. His major starring film roles include "New Battles Without Honor and Humanity" (2000), "The Traitor," "Southbound," and "Confession of Murder" (2007), "My Darling Is a Wife" and "The Sword of Farewell" (2010), "A Single Postcard" (2011), "The Long Excuse" (2016), "Paradise Next" (2019), "My Brother, Android and Me" and "The Wandering Ghost" (2022), and "The Shogun's Clerk, Baian Fujieda" Parts 1 & 2 (2023). In the 2020 Hollywood film "Midway," he played Admiral Isoroku Yamamoto of the Combined Fleet, receiving critical acclaim. He has also appeared in notable films such as "Kingdom II: To the Land Beyond" (2022), "And Then I Was Bored" and "Revolver Lily" (2023), and "Kingdom: The Battle of Souls" (2026). He starred in "The Ground Transaction Men" (Netflix/2024) and "No Activity" Season 2 (Prime Video/2024).
President: Kazunori Kishibe
Born in 1947 in Kyoto Prefecture. He received the Japan Academy Prize for Best Actor for "The Thorn of Death" (1990) and the Japan Academy Prize for Outstanding Supporting Actor for "We Are All Alive" and "Dying to Live" (1993). His other works include films such as "One Day, I Will Read" (2005), "The Great Deer Village Incident" (2011), "Outrage: Final Chapter" (2017), "The Cherry Blossom Guardian" and "The Lies of the Suzuki Family" (2018), "Never Been Shot" (2020), and "The Great Yokai War: Guardians" (2023), as well as TV dramas such as the "AIBOU" series (EX/2002-10), the "Iryu - Team Medical Dragon -" series (CX/2006-14), the "Doctor-X: Surgeon Michiko Daimon" series (EX/2012-21), and the "Muyoan Kyokyo Shugyo" series (BS Asahi/2017-26). In recent years, he has appeared in the film "Theatrical Version Doctor-X FINAL" (2024) and the drama "Friendship with Tanaka-san, Who Was My Age Back Then" (NHK/2024).

What is kintone
Cybozu's business improvement platform used by over 42,000 companies. It allows users to create apps tailored to their company's operations with no-code, low-code, and AI, even without IT knowledge, enabling quick and low-cost business improvements. Its main functions include "database," "communication," and "process management." It can be used for a wide range of purposes such as customer management, travel requests, and daily reports, thereby achieving site-led continuous business improvement.
